Ni-Co Energy begins 7,500-meter drill program at Québec Kremer nickel-copper-cobalt project
  • Ni-Co Energy began a 7,500-meter drill program at its 100%-owned Kremer nickel-copper-cobalt project in Québec.
  • Initial drilling targets Kremer-2, the top-priority untested area, where surface sampling returned up to 1.21% Ni.
  • Program will run in two phases to test key electromagnetic conductors, then tighten drilling on the most prospective zones.
  • Follow-up drilling at Kremer-1 aims to better define widths, geometry, and continuity of sulphide zones intersected in 2023.
  • Work tests part of an 8-km corridor; additional targets, including Kremer-3, remain for later evaluation.
